Paul Muigai is a professional with extensive experience in the information technology and business development sectors. Currently, Paul serves as a Business Development and Cloud Consultant at Nascent Technologies, having held the role since 2022. Concurrently, Paul has been an IT Support Specialist at City Eye Hospital since January 2018, where responsibilities included sourcing and deploying Microsoft's Business Central ERP system. Previously, Paul was a Business Development Executive at KINGS OPHTHALMICS LIMITED from June 2015 to December 2017, focusing on market research, client account management, and sales of medical equipment. Paul also worked as a Help Desk Technician at UPPERHILL EYE & LASER CENTRE between June 2011 and December 2014, where duties involved local area network maintenance and computer troubleshooting. Educational credentials include a Bachelor's degree in Information Technology from Jomo Kenyatta University of Agriculture and Technology and a Higher Diploma in Management of Information Systems from KCA University.

City Eye Hospital is a social venture headquartered in Nairobi that provides quality and affordable eye care. Our primary goal is to eliminate preventable blindness in the East African region by improving the accessibility of eye care, both in terms of location and price. Since our inception in 2015, we have achieved remarkable success, increasing the number of patients seen annually at City Eye Hospital more than sevenfold. Through the City Eye Foundation, we are supporting the effort to eradicate preventable blindness throughout East Africa. By funding community outreach programs, we have provided free health services to more than 80,000 people from communities, performed more than 4,000 cataract surgeries, and delivered more than 6,000 early interventions to people at risk of going blind.
